Output faf804c1238dac79fe57f7110c70d763106ad3ebda4eb6415f3136e0270668e9:0

value
8743964
script pubkey
OP_0 OP_PUSHBYTES_20 70b0370d3a48676861b7a7ef7d39a2af1da93ab5
address
bc1qwzcrwrf6fpnkscdh5lhh6wdz4uw6jw44652pu7
transaction
faf804c1238dac79fe57f7110c70d763106ad3ebda4eb6415f3136e0270668e9
confirmations
224590
spent
true